What is Vaping?

Vaping is the act of inhaling and exhaling vapor produced by an electronic cigarette or other vaping devices. E-cigarettes are battery-powered devices that heat a liquid (usually containing nicotine, flavorings, and other chemicals) into an aerosol that is inhaled. Vaping is often marketed as a safer alternative to smoking traditional cigarettes, but it still carries risks and potential health consequences.

Components of a Vape

A vape device typically consists of four main components: a battery, a heating element, a reservoir for the e-liquid, and a mouthpiece. The battery provides power to the heating element, which vaporizes the e-liquid. The vapor is then inhaled through the mouthpiece. Some vape devices also have adjustable settings that allow users to control the temperature and amount of vapor produced.

Popular Vape Devices

There are many different types of vaping devices available on the market, each with its own unique features and design. Some of the most popular types of vape devices include:

  • Pod systems: These compact devices are designed for ease of use and portability. They typically have a small battery and a refillable or replaceable pod that contains the e-liquid and heating element.
  • Vape pens: These devices are similar in size and shape to a pen, and are often used by beginners. They typically have a larger battery and a refillable tank for the e-liquid.
  • Box mods: These larger, more powerful devices are often used by experienced vapers who want more control over their vaping experience. They typically have a larger battery, adjustable settings, and a refillable tank for the e-liquid.

Age Restrictions

In most states, the legal age to purchase and use vaping products is 21 years old. However, some states have set the legal age at 18 or 19. It is important to be aware of the laws in your state to avoid getting into trouble. If you are caught vaping underage, you may face fines, community service, or other penalties.

Public Space Regulations

Many states have regulations on where you can vape in public. Some states prohibit vaping in public spaces altogether, while others allow it in certain designated areas. It is important to be aware of the rules in your state to avoid getting into trouble. If you are caught vaping in a non-designated area, you may face fines or other penalties.

In addition to state regulations, many cities and towns have their own rules regarding vaping in public spaces. For example, some cities have banned vaping in parks or on beaches. It is important to be aware of the rules in your area to avoid getting into trouble.

Vape Detection Devices

Finally, there are vape detection devices that can be used to detect vape usage. These devices are often used in public places like schools, airports, and hotels to ensure that people aren’t vaping where they shouldn’t be. Vape detectors work by detecting the chemicals in e-liquid and can alert security personnel if someone is vaping in a prohibited area.

Health Implications of Vaping

Vaping is often touted as a safer alternative to smoking, but it still poses health risks. Here are some of the short-term and long-term effects of vaping.

Short Term Effects

  • Nicotine addiction: Vaping exposes you to nicotine, which is highly addictive. Nicotine can lead to increased heart rate, elevated blood pressure, and narrowing of the arteries.

  • Irritation of the lungs: Vaping can cause irritation of the lungs, leading to coughing, wheezing, and shortness of breath.

  • Dry mouth and throat: Vaping can cause dry mouth and throat, which can lead to bad breath and an increased risk of tooth decay.

  • Headaches: Some people may experience headaches after vaping, which can be caused by the nicotine or other chemicals in the e-liquid.

Long Term Effects

  • Lung damage: Vaping can cause lung damage, including inflammation and scarring of the lung tissue. This can lead to ch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) and other respiratory problems.

  • Increased risk of cancer: Vaping exposes you to chemicals that can increase your risk of cancer, including formaldehyde and acetaldehyde.

  • Heart disease: Vaping can increase your risk of heart disease, including heart attacks and strokes. Nicotine can cause your blood vessels to narrow, which can lead to high blood pressure and other cardiovascular problems.

  • Reproductive problems: Vaping can affect your reproductive health, including reducing fertility and increasing the risk of birth defects.

It’s important to note that the long-term effects of vaping are still being studied, and more research is needed to fully understand the health implications. If you’re concerned about the health risks of vaping, talk to your doctor or a healthcare professional.
